[算表] 用excel彙總通過名單
軟體: excel
版本: 2003/2007 都有
因為我們最近在用一個活動
有審核機制的(人工審核)
然後會分成2個階段
工作底稿長得會像
姓名 第一階段 第二階段
aa ok ok
bb ok
cc ok ok
dd ok ok
ee ok
ff
gg ok
hh ok ok
2階段都ok的就是通過的名單
因為是進行式
所以需要把目前通過的名單另外列出來
目前是採人工的方式去對
但因為是一群共用一份文件,
每次都要再重對一次
不知道有什麼方法可以直接產出
通過名單
aa
cc
dd
hh
這樣的東西嗎
另外因為筆數很多
希望可以50筆就換下一欄
不然通過名單會很長,不太好看
謝謝
--
沒靈感
http://bogo.666forum.com/ 實驗中
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 114.32.36.252
→
04/11 22:19, , 1F
04/11 22:19, 1F
→
04/11 23:11, , 2F
04/11 23:11, 2F
因為工作底稿仍持續作業
名單一直有更新
用篩選的話就是要不斷手動更新
容易有時間差
集中是什麼呀
我不會用
→
04/11 23:30, , 3F
04/11 23:30, 3F
→
04/11 23:31, , 4F
04/11 23:31, 4F
昨天有google到函數了
謝謝大家的幫忙
※ 編輯: docse 來自: 115.43.128.253 (04/12 16:59)
推
04/12 18:27, , 5F
04/12 18:27, 5F
推
04/12 22:11, , 6F
04/12 22:11, 6F
ok
我剛再去找,忘了當時是怎麼找到的
只能分享有改過的公式喔
我的表單格式大概是
A B C D E
姓名 Email 已通過 第一階段 第二階段
aa xxx okok ok ok
bb xxx ok ok
cc xxx okok ok ok
dd xxx okok ok ok
我先加一欄工作欄,讓 C=D&E 先找到2階段都通過的
然後在某欄 輸入函數
=IF(COUNTIF($C:$C,"ok")<ROW(A2),"",
INDEX($A:$A,SMALL(IF($C$2:$C$1199="ok",ROW($C$2:$C$1199),4^8),ROW(A2))))
為陣列公式
就會自動代出
aa
cc
dd
這樣的清單 (自動略過不合條件的)
然後再用offset去產出5欄自動換列的清單
雖然有結果了
但那個陣列公式其實有點看不懂 (汗顏)
和大家分享
如果有人願意說明就更好了 ^^
謝謝
※ 編輯: docse 來自: 114.32.36.252 (04/17 21:18)
Office 近期熱門文章
PTT數位生活區 即時熱門文章